Green Party of Aotearoa New Zealand Sue Kedgley

Reduce fees charged for public information and ensure that access to information has primacy over cost-recovery
Ensure easy access to public information in cases involving public money or resource consents
Ensure that all government information and advice is made available to the public archives after 25 years
Support the review of the Privacy Act 1993 and the Official Information Act 1982, to improve the public's access to information and ensure that there are effective reviews in place for those who do not receive the requested information
